What are the important achievements in the early years of Mozart's life?

Mozart's most important achievement in his early years would be surviving birth. This is not a joke or a poor attempt an an answer. Of the seven children birthed by his mother, only Wolfgang Amadeus and one sister survived.At a very early age, 4 or 5, Mozart could read and write music, and was very gifted on the piano and violin. Mozart composed two rather short songs when he was five years old. He wrote and played his "Andante" and "Allegro in C" for his father.Mozart composed 13 symphonies between the ages of 8 and 15.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art was definitely a child prodigy.

Is the term classical refers to music that is performed only in symphonies?

No; classical is a style of music with a tradition that reaches back into the Middle Ages. It is typically instrumental, although occasionally poems or lyrics were added. Percussion is minimal, with low strings or bass brass instruments providing much of the tempo and beat. Most classical music is scored primarily for piano or strings, with woodwinds and brass instruments providing bulk or contrast when needed. There are thousands of classical-style compositions that were written specifically for soloists, duets, trios and quartets. Also, there were many compositions for chamber orchestras (which are much smaller than symphonies) and partial symphonies. However, the above describes traditional classical music - with the rise in popularity of neo-classical music, the above traditions can be bent and skewed in interesting ways.

What did Mozart do for his spare time during the ages of 7- 15?

Around that age, the Mozart family did a lot of travelling around Europe. Wolfgang's father, Leopold Mozart, bought a small clavier to take with them so that they (Wolfgang and his sister, Maria Anna) could practice. When not on the move, Maria Anna, or Nannerl, would write small pieces of music and practice, but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art would play with the local children, or go sightseeing.
